Panasonic FH3 vs Pentax E70 Overview

Here is a in-depth overview of the Panasonic FH3 and Pentax E70, both Small Sensor Compact digital cameras by brands Panasonic and Pentax. There is a big difference between the sensor resolutions of the FH3 (14MP) and E70 (10MP) but they use the exact same sensor sizing (1/2.3").

The FH3 was released 13 months later than the E70 which makes the cameras a generation apart from each other. Both the cameras come with the identical body type (Compact).

Panasonic FH3 vs Pentax E70 Physical Comparison

When you are planning to carry your camera frequently, you are going to need to factor its weight and proportions. The Panasonic FH3 enjoys outer dimensions of 98mm x 55mm x 24mm (3.9" x 2.2" x 0.9") accompanied by a weight of 165 grams (0.36 lbs) and the Pentax E70 has measurements of 94mm x 61mm x 26mm (3.7" x 2.4" x 1.0") along with a weight of 175 grams (0.39 lbs).

Panasonic FH3 vs Pentax E70 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it is difficult to visualise the gap between sensor sizing simply by reading specs. The photograph below may provide you a more clear sense of the sensor dimensions in the FH3 and E70.

All in all, the 2 cameras have got the exact same sensor measurements albeit not the same megapixels. You should count on the Panasonic FH3 to offer more detail as a result of its extra 4 Megapixels. Higher resolution will also help you crop photographs much more aggressively. The fresher FH3 is going to have an advantage when it comes to sensor technology.
